Windows 10 and 11 turned Windows Media Player into an optional component that might simply be turned off on your system.
If you are using a standard version of Windows, the player might simply be deactivated. You can turn it back on through the Control Panel. Press the to open the Run dialog box. Type optionalfeatures.exe and press Enter . windows media player version 10 or later is required work

If the error persists after enabling WMP, or if the checkbox was already ticked, try this "off-on-again" method to perform a clean reinstall of the feature.
If the app requires a specific format that the default player can't read, installing a codec pack can bridge the gap. Use a trusted source like the K-Lite Codec Pack to ensure your system can handle varied media formats. ✅ Result The error is resolved by enabling "Windows Media Player Legacy" Windows Features menu or installing the Media Feature Pack if you are on an N-edition of Windows. This error is highly common on modern operating systems like Windows 10 and Windows 11. It usually happens because modern Windows versions use a completely different framework for media playback, leaving older software unable to detect the built-in media features.
: Go to Settings > Apps > Optional features (or "Manage optional features"). Click Add a feature , search for Windows Media Player Legacy , and select Install .
